POWER TRAIN - AUTOMATIC TRANSMISSION
00V377000LAND ROVER NORTH AMERICA, INC.from 10/01/1998 to 10/31/2000V (Vehicle)5944501/04/2001MFRLAND ROVER11/16/200011/29/2000571114
Defect SummaryVehicle description: certain sport utility v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of fmvss no. 114, theft protection. water contamination of the automatic transmission oil can lead to various failure modes of the transmission. one of these failure models results in incorrect operation of the park lock function that could allow a vehicle to roll away if parked without the handbrake properly set.
Consequence SummaryUnintentional vehicle movement could result in a crash or personal injury.
Corrective SummaryDealers will check the park lock function; reposition the automatic transmission breather tube; and test the automatic transmission fluid and flush if necessary.

POWER TRAIN - DRIVELINE - DRIVESHAFT

Defect SummaryJaguar land rover north america, inc. (land rover) is recalling certain rear driveshaft couplings, land rover branded part number tvf100010, manufactured from april 2011 through november 2011, sold for use as service parts for certain model year 1995-1999 discovery, 1999-2004 discovery ii, and 1995 range rover classic vehicles. some of the rear driveshaft couplings may not have been manufactured to the required engineering design specifications and may exhibit the onset of joint separation, precluded by drive line vibration.
Consequence SummaryIf this increased vibration warning sign is ignored, catastrophic failure of the drive coupling can occur. the driveshaft may detach from the vehicle while in motion resulting in loss of drive and loss of transmission park functionality, increasing the risk of a vehicle crash and/or injury.
Corrective SummaryLand rover will notify owners, and dealers will replace the affected rear driveshaft couplers free of charge. the recall is expected to begin on or about april 23, 2012. owners may contact jaguar land rover north america at 1-201-818-8500.

SERVICE BRAKES, HYDRAULIC - ANTILOCK

Defect SummaryVehicle description: passenger vehicles. the contacts of the relay, which operates the anti-lock brake system (abs) pump, can stick and remain closed when commanded to open by the abs electronic control unit. the warning lamp will illuminate and an audible alarm will sound.
Consequence SummaryAnti-lock braking will stop and the vehicle may experience inadvertent braking for less than a second.
Corrective SummaryDealers will replace the abs relay.
